Jaipur Airport: ‘Udaan Yatri Café’ Launched, Breakfast Available for ₹10

Union Minister Ram Mohan Naidu inaugurated the facility.


Providing relief to air travelers, the first Udaan Yatri Café in the state has been launched at Jaipur International Airport. Union Civil Aviation Minister Ram Mohan Naidu virtually inaugurated it in Kishangarh.

With the opening of this café, passengers will now get food items at affordable prices at the airport. According to airport authorities, the café located in the pre-check-in area of Terminal 2 will offer tea, coffee, water, samosas, and sweets at reasonable rates.

The airport management stated that this facility has been started under the Udaan scheme, especially keeping common passengers in mind, so that air travelers can get affordable food options at lower prices.
